Advantages of Solar Security Cameras

Solar security cameras offer several benefits when compared to their conventional counterparts. First and foremost, they are an environmentally friendly solution, significantly reducing carbon footprint. By harnessing renewable solar energy, these cameras minimize electricity costs, thus saving you money in the long run.

Additionally, solar security cameras function incredibly well in areas with limited or no access to electricity, making them perfect for remote locations. As for reliability, these cameras continue to record and monitor even when regular grid power outages happen.

Another advantage to note is their ease of installation, since solar security cameras don't require wiring. This factor speeds up the setup process and allows for greater flexibility when deciding on the most ideal mounting location.

Key Considerations When Choosing a Solar Security Camera

Before investing in a solar security camera, keep these factors in mind:

1. Camera resolution: Higher resolution corresponds to clearer images, enabling better identification of individuals and finer details. Opt for a camera that offers at least 1080p HD resolution.

2. Battery backup: Solar cameras should have a reliable battery backup for nights or cloudy days. Check the camera's battery capacity and make sure it can last several hours without charging.

3. Motion detection and alerts: An effective security camera should provide real-time alerts upon detecting movements. Look for cameras with adjustable motion sensitivity to avoid false alarms triggered by leaves or small animals.

4. Night vision: Since many security incidents occur in low-light conditions, your solar camera should have a robust night vision feature, capable of capturing detailed images at night or in dimly lit areas.

5. Weather resistance: Your solar security camera will be exposed to the elements, so make sure it's weather-resistant and suitable for your local climate. Look for an IP65 or IP66 rating, which stands for dust and water resistance.

FAQs: Answering Common Questions About Solar Security Cameras

Do solar-powered security cameras work at night?

Yes, solar-powered security cameras work at night using energy stored during the day. They are equipped with night vision capabilities, which use infrared technology to capture detailed images in low-light settings.

Do solar cameras need Wi-Fi?

Wi-Fi connectivity is required for streaming live footage, receiving instant alerts, and accessing stored recordings on most solar cameras. However, some solar cameras offer cellular or wired connections as alternatives.
